Last week, we spent some time catching up on content because of all of our crazy snow/ice/cold days. However, we did find time to read some fun Valentine stories! This is one of my favorites and the kids absolutely LOVED IT! The story is about a boy who is IN LOVE with a girl and makes a Valentine for her. The Valentine, however, thinks love is disgusting and decides to run away! You can follow the two on the fun adventure they have as the Valentine continues to run until something happens.....
